Background technology:
The circular screen printer used in textile mills is the jointless cylinder using continuous rotary Screen cloth carries out a kind of screen printing machine of stamp.Circular screen printer forms combination machine with other unit Use, can be used for bafta, chemical fibre and blend fabric thereof and general knitted fabric, the print of silk fabrics Flower, its be suitable for raw material variety have: polyamide multifilament (line), polypropylene filament yarn (line), polypropylene, Terylene, nylon, PP, low bullet, high-elastic, cotton thread yarn (line), pearly-lustre line, skin material, mixing Deng.Circular screen printer is rational in infrastructure, processing ease, and production efficiency is high, is therefore widely used in Textile manufacturing field, and guide belt of decorating machine is the parts that printing machine transmits cloth, works as patterning machines During running, print guide belt can rotate along with the motion of machine, and cloth is attached to circular screen printer On print guide belt, then wire mark or cylinder print material are on former cloth.Finish printing rear stamp to lead The surface of band can remain mill base, it is therefore desirable to being carried out print guide belt, current stamp is led The water washing device of band is all to soak in water to complete by the way of disposable washing, this kind of mode The most this cleaning way not only cleaning performance is the best, and wastes substantial amounts of washing liquid resource, cleans After completing, it is all with scraper, print guide belt to be anhydrated, print guide belt can not be cleaned completely On dirt.

The overflow washing device of a kind of circular screen printer, including print guide belt be arranged on stamp and lead Below belting and multiple washing trough of being arranged in order, described clear, washing trough is internally provided with and is positioned at The multiple belt hold rollers arranged on conduction band transmission path, and contact with the end face of print guide belt Brush roll, it is characterised in that: described each washing trough is equipped with a water inlet and an outlet, Pipeline entering previous washing trough outlet and later washing trough it is provided with between adjacent tank The mouth of a river is connected, and the height of described leftmost side washing trough water inlet is higher than rightmost side sink outlet Highly, left side washing trough is connected with aqua storage tank, and abluent is by the washing trough being arranged in described low order end Water inlet enters, and flows successively through multiple washing trough, and by being arranged in the going out of washing trough of described rearmost end The mouth of a river is flowed out.
By technique scheme, sparge pipe carries out first step cleaning to print guide belt device, then By brush roll, print guide belt is carried out secondary flushing, and cleanout fluid is entered by the total water inlet of washing trough Enter, flow out from outlet after sequentially passing through the water inlet of each little washing trough, and enter into the next one Washing trough, until flowing to be arranged in last washing trough, discharges through total outlet, and during cleaning, stamp is led The direction of tape running and washing liquid flow through the in opposite direction of washing trough, when cleanout fluid is successively by each washing trough stream When entering in the washing trough being arranged in below, cleanout fluid can be more and more muddy, therefore works as print guide belt When direction and the washing liquid run flows through washing trough in opposite direction, conduction band first runs and enters washing below During groove, conduction band can be cleaned with more muddy cleanout fluid, be arranged in along with conduction band sequentially enters In the washing trough of front end, the washing liquid in washing trough is more and more cleaner, and print guide belt is cleaner, So also more preferable to the cleaning performance of conduction band, and washing liquid can be saved, it is unlikely to conduction band direct In entrance washing trough, the whole washing trough of 20 all does muddy, and the most cleaned print guide belt is through overdrying Dry device, is dried to print guide belt by heater plate and blower fan so that print guide belt is dried, Prevent the problem that operator slide into because water droplet drips to ground.
